【mysql 127错误】mysql启动报错mysqld.service: Failed with result ‘exit-code‘.
报错信息 "mysqld.service: Failed with result 'exit-code'" 表示 MySQL 服务启动失败,但没有提供具体的退出代码。这种情况通常会伴随具体的退出代码,例如 'exit-code 1' 或 'exit-code 2'。
解决方法:
查看 MySQL 错误日志:
使用命令
journalctl -u mysqld
查看 MySQL 服务的详细启动日志。检查配置文件:
确认
/etc/my.cnf
或/etc/mysql/my.cnf
配置文件中的设置是否正确。检查磁盘空间:
确保服务器上有足够的磁盘空间。
检查权限问题:
确保 MySQL 数据目录的权限正确。
检查端口冲突:
确保 MySQL 配置的端口没有被其他服务占用。
修复安装:
如果是通过包管理器安装的 MySQL,可以尝试使用包管理器修复安装。
重新启动服务:
在做完上述检查和修改后,尝试重新启动 MySQL 服务。
查看系统日志:
检查系统日志
/var/log/syslog
或使用dmesg
命令查看内核日志,可能会有更多线索。
如果以上步骤不能解决问题,可能需要更详细的错误信息来进行针对性的排查。
评论已关闭